Bacterial Flagellar Type III Secretion System

Abstract
Flagella are appendages present on bacterial surface involved in swimming. Flagellum is a complex nanomachine made up of about 25 different proteins. It is composed of an extracellular filament, a membrane assembly (basal body) and cytoplasmic components. A type III protein export apparatus is present in the membrane assembly. It transports proteins through the membrane – which then assemble to form the flagellar filament. This work is based on characterisation of one of the export apparatus proteins, FlhA.
